1. 确认vue3-tree-org组件的右键默认行为 首先,你需要确认vue3-tree-org组件是否默认处理右键点击事件。这通常可以通过查看组件的文档或源代码来确定。如果组件没有提供直接的方式来阻止右键行为,你将需要通过自定义事件处理器来实现。 2. 研究vue3-tree-org组件的文档 虽然这里没有提供具体的文档链接,但你应该查找...
支持自定义右键菜单 支持slot自定义节点渲染内容 支持slot自定义展开按钮渲染内容 安装 npm install vue3-tree-org --save # or yarn add vue3-tree-org 引入 import { createApp } from 'vue' import vue3TreeOrg from 'vue3-tree-org'; import "vue3-tree-org/lib/vue3-tree-org.css"; const app ...
支持自定义右键菜单 支持slot自定义节点渲染内容 支持slot自定义展开按钮渲染内容 安装 npm install vue3-tree-org --save # or yarn add vue3-tree-org 引入 import { createApp } from 'vue' import vue3TreeOrg from 'vue3-tree-org'; import "vue3-tree-org/lib/vue3-tree-org.css"; const app...
在vue3TreeOrg中,可以通过监听事件来实现节点的展开、折叠、选中、右键菜单等交互操作。 可以使用自定义CSS样式来设置节点、节点的展开/折叠图标、节点选中状态等外观样式。 总之,使用vue3TreeOrg可以方便地展示和管理树形结构数据,并支持丰富的节点操作和自定义样式。具体使用方法和规则可以参考官方文档或示例代码。©...
@@ -36,6 +36,6 @@ 或者通过props指定id和pid属性 2.由于节点拖拽功能阻止了节点文本选中,所以,在右键菜单中提供了复制节点文本功能。 # Props参数
--[--><!--[--><!--]--> 介绍<!--[--><!--]--><!--[--><!--[--><!--[--><!--]--> 介绍<!--[--><!--]--><!---><
本次版本为公开版本,支持了Tree和Timeline模版功能。以下是该模版的目前支持的功能截图。 移除Shadcn UI 原始代码优化启动编译方式 树形组件 树形组件自定义 Slot + 右键菜单 时间线组件 时间线组件 Milestone 时间线组件 Progress 时间线组件 Discussion 该模版的使用方式比较简单只要传递相应的数据即可,也支持多个 slot...
新增上下文菜单组件和树右键菜单支持分组项界面行为组展开模式 新增工具栏在设计模式下拦截所有按钮的点击Changed面包屑组件识别视图标识改为codeName、面包屑组件适配模态、模态路由模式、面包屑组件支持多首页Fixed修复水平模式下drbar分组样式异常、显示更多界面卡死 修复临时数据模式下脏值检查异常(顶层视图数据是否变更需要...
const menuOptions=ref(getTreeRoutes(mainRoutes)) const menuFilterOptions=computed(()=>{if(props.rootRouteEnable) {returnmenuOptions.value }//过滤掉一级菜单returnmenuOptions.value.find(item=>item.path==rootRoute.value&&item.children)?.children ...
为自定义类型 interface SpiderStoreState { sidebarCollapsed: boolean; actionsCollapsed: boolean; tabs: NavItem[]; } // Getters // StoreGetter 为自定义基础类型 interface SpiderStoreGetters extends GetterTree{ tabName: StoreGetter; } // Mutations // StoreMutation 为自定义基础类型 interface SpiderStore...